Personal Financial Management and Financial Literacy
Connecticut schools are required to provide learning opportunities for all students to accumulate one-half credit in personal financial management and financial literacy courses commencing with the graduating class of 2027.
Designing a Grading System - Mastery-Based Learning
In every grading system, numbers or letters are merely signifiers, and their meaning is entirely derived from the reliability of the systems used to make a grading determination. In other words, the accuracy, authority, and dependability of all grades depend on the quality of the methods used to award them.
Guide to Assessments for Educator Certification in Connecticut
Applicants seeking certification in Connecticut generally must pass one or more of the following assessments depending on the endorsement areas sought. Applicants should apply for certification and submit all requested documentation to determine specific testing requirements.
